Business roof in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a commercial property's roofing system to identify potential issues before they develop into costly problems. Skilled service providers typically examine the entire roof surface, checking for signs of damage, wear, or deterioration. This process may include inspecting for leaks, cracks, damaged flashing, loose or missing shingles, and areas where water might be pooling. Regular inspections help ensure the roof remains in good condition, extending its lifespan and maintaining the property's overall integrity.

These inspections are especially valuable for addressing common roofing problems such as leaks, which can cause water damage to the interior structure, or the presence of damaged flashing that allows moisture intrusion. Identifying small issues early can prevent them from escalating into more serious and expensive repairs. Additionally, inspections can reveal structural weaknesses, algae or moss growth, and other signs of aging that might compromise the roof’s ability to protect the building effectively.

The types of properties that typically utilize roof inspection services include commercial buildings like offices, retail stores, warehouses, and industrial facilities. Apartment complexes and multi-family housing units also benefit from regular roof assessments to maintain safety and compliance. Even some larger residential properties with extensive or complex roofing systems may require professional inspections to ensure all components are functioning properly. These services are particularly important for properties in areas prone to severe weather, where the risk of damage is higher.

The overview below groups typical Business Roof Inspection proj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Nashua, NH.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for routine roof inspections and minor repairs in Nashua range from $250 to $600. Many projects fall within this band, especially for straightforward inspections and small fixes.

Moderate Projects - More comprehensive inspections or moderate repairs usually cost between $600 and $1,200. These are common for mid-sized commercial or residential roofs needing detailed assessments.

Major Repairs - Larger, more complex projects such as extensive patching or partial repairs can range from $1,200 to $3,500. Fewer projects reach into this higher tier, but they are necessary for significant damage.

Full Roof Replacement - Complete roof replacements in the area tend to start at $5,000 and can go higher depending on size and materials. Most projects in this range are larger jobs requiring extensive work by local contractors.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What does a roof inspection include? A roof inspection typically involves checking for damaged or missing shingles, signs of leaks, and overall roof condition to identify potential issues.

How often should a roof be inspected? It is recommended to have a roof inspected at least once a year or after severe weather events to ensure its integrity.

What are signs that a roof might need repair? Visible signs include curling or missing shingles, water stains on ceilings, and granules in gutters, indicating possible damage.

Can a roof inspection help prevent costly repairs? Yes, regular inspections can identify small problems early, potentially avoiding more extensive and expensive repairs later.
